Problem

Conventional pipettes require excessive grip force, especially when placing the pipette tip, due to a lack of adequate support for the hand, leading to user discomfort and fatigue.

Innovation Solution

The pipette features a lower support protrusion at the handle's lower edge, which is adjustable in height and rotation, providing additional grip stability and reducing the need for excessive grip force, combined with a finger support and optional connecting support section for improved ergonomics.

Solution Approach 1:

The handle structure is segmented into multiple functional zones: upper finger support, middle lower support, and lower support. Each segment provides specific ergonomic functionality, with the lower support being a distinct protrusion that prevents hand sliding without requiring excessive grip force.

Solution Approach 2:

The lower support protrudes radially from the handle surface in a direction perpendicular to the longitudinal axis, creating a third-dimensional contact point for the hand. This radial protrusion provides additional support in the downward direction without increasing the handle's longitudinal or radial dimensions significantly.

Solution Approach 1:

The lower support transitions from a fixed static structure to a dynamic adjustable one. It can be positioned at different heights along the handle and rotated to different angular positions, allowing adaptation to various hand sizes and gripping preferences while maintaining structural simplicity.

Solution Approach 1:

The lower support provides localized ergonomic enhancement at a specific position on the handle. The protrusion is concentrated in a small radial region (3-8 mm from surface) rather than uniformly increasing the handle dimensions, providing targeted grip stability improvement with minimal impact on overall manufacturing tolerances.

A support pipette including at least one cylinder with an upper end and a lower end, each cylinder having a movable piston, and an elongate handle (1) with an upper part and a lower part, at which handle the pipette can be manually gripped, wherein the lower part (13.1; 13.2; 13.3) of the handle (1) includes a sideways protruding lower support (10.1; 10.2; 10.3; 10.4; 10.5).
